For Android & iOSI approached JB4 Mobile as a driver would use it in real life: not as a general sports tracker, but as a companion for a vehicle already equipped with a JB4 tuner. That distinction matters immediately. The app’s job is to act as a data logger and display, giving the driver a way to observe information related to the tuner rather than replacing the tuner or turning an ordinary car into a tuned one.
In my experience, that makes it a focused tool with a fairly narrow audience. If you already use JB4 hardware and want a mobile view of what is happening during a drive, it can be useful. If you are looking for a casual performance dashboard, a route recorder, or a universal car-monitoring app, I would look elsewhere. The value here comes from the connection between the app and the JB4 setup, not from broad compatibility with every vehicle or tuning system.

What the app actually adds to the JB4 experience
The core benefit is visibility. A JB4 tuner can change the way a vehicle behaves, but without useful feedback, the owner is left relying on impressions such as throttle response or acceleration feel. JB4 Mobile gives that setup a mobile-facing data layer. I found that more valuable than a flashy interface would be, because tuning decisions are easier to discuss when they are connected to recorded information rather than memory.
A useful workflow is to keep the first drive conservative. I would begin by confirming that the phone can communicate with the JB4 arrangement, then make a short, repeatable drive rather than immediately attempting a dramatic test. Repeating the same stretch under similar conditions makes the log easier to interpret. It also prevents a common mistake: blaming the app or the tune for changes caused by traffic, weather, fuel, or a different driving style.
Another practical insight is to separate observation from adjustment. I would not change a setting simply because one screen looks unusual during one run. First, I would save or review the available information, compare it with another drive, and then decide whether a change is justified. The app is most useful when it supports a disciplined process, not when it encourages constant experimentation.
That is where it differs from ordinary automotive alternatives. A generic dashboard app may focus on broad vehicle information, while a racing-oriented logger may be designed for a different hardware ecosystem. JB4 Mobile makes more sense when the JB4 tuner is already the center of the workflow. Its specialization is a strength for the right owner and a limitation for everyone else.

A simple pre-drive conversation can prevent most household friction. Decide whether the goal is to collect a normal commute, compare two familiar routes, or evaluate a particular change. Without that goal, the driver may treat the session as a performance challenge, while the tuner is actually looking for clean, consistent information. Those are not the same thing.
One of my favorite ways to use a specialized logger is to create a baseline before making changes. Take a few ordinary drives, note the conditions in plain language, and only then compare later sessions. This helps reveal whether a perceived improvement is consistent. It also reduces the temptation to make several changes at once, which makes the result much harder to understand.

What is JB4 Mobile and what does it do?
JB4 Mobile is an advanced tuning application designed for automotive enthusiasts who want to optimize their vehicle's performance. The app connects to a JB4 tuner, allowing users to monitor and customize their car's engine settings in real-time through their mobile device. It's ideal for those looking to enhance horsepower, torque, and fuel efficiency.
Is JB4 Mobile compatible with all vehicles?
JB4 Mobile is specifically designed to work with vehicles equipped with a JB4 tuner. It supports a wide range of car models, particularly those from brands like BMW, Audi, and Volkswagen. However, it's essential to check the compatibility of your car model with the JB4 tuner before downloading the app to ensure proper functionality.
